Creating a Company in Saudi Arabia: Regulations and Requirements
Venturing into the Saudi Arabian market requires understanding the intricate system governing company formation. To initiate this endeavor, entrepreneurs must comply with specific directives outlined by the Ministry of Commerce and Investment (MCI). A key necessity is acquiring a valid Saudi Arabian business license, which requires submitting a comprehensive application outlining the company's purpose of activities. The application must include detailed facts about the company's legal structure, ownership composition, registered office, and proposed team.
Moreover, foreign investors may need to navigate additional requirements, such as partnering with a local investor or obtaining consent from relevant government departments. It is highly advised to seek professional assistance from legal and financial experts familiar with the Saudi Arabian commercial landscape.
Facilitating Company Formation in Saudi Arabia Across the Lifecycle
Saudi Arabia has undergone a significant transformation, bolstering its economy and attracting foreign investment. This dynamic shift has resulted an increasing demand for transparent and efficient company formation processes. Recognizing this need, the government has implemented various initiatives to streamline company registration, making it more accessible and investor-attractive.
One key aspect of this reform is the automation of the process. The establishment of online platforms has enabled entrepreneurs and investors to complete many steps remotely, significantly reducing the time and effort required for registration.
Furthermore, Saudi Arabia has simplified its regulatory framework, making it more transparent. This includes introducing a single-window system where businesses can access all necessary services in one place.
- Such reforms have not only facilitated business growth but have also enhanced Saudi Arabia's image as a attractive destination for investment.
